## Pagination Checks

The public Larkfield REST API pages results with opaque cursors; never assume numeric offsets. When validating a reported pagination bug, replay the failing request sequence against the internal mirror at the Brindlewood staging cluster, which logs cursor state per request. The mirror requires authentication even for read-only calls, unlike production. Use the internal service key below for all mirror requests:

service key, kaduf-bawig: kto15_Ze79S0dligTw0yO

## Stringpull setup

Stringpull extracts translation strings from the Lexivo app and pushes them to the phrase catalog. Clone the repo, run `make deps`, copy `env.sample` to `.env`. Set `SP_SOURCE_DIR` to the app checkout and `SP_LOCALES` to the target list. Pushing to the catalog requires an upload credential. Add that line to `.env` now:

vault entry, kagep-yajeg: COURIER_KEY5=da097

On-call,

We confirmed the planner regression introduced in last week's Lanternbase release: join reordering now ignores the cardinality hints on partitioned tables, so the Ostermill workload's nightly rollups chose nested loops over hash joins, inflating runtime roughly 14x. The hotfix restores hint precedence and adds a guard test against the Ostermill fixture set. Please monitor planner latency dashboards for two hours after rollout and page the storage team if p99 regresses again. Reference this trace token when escalating.

build token for kagaf-hahof: htk14_9d3d4d26d7d8de

Hi, welcome to on-call for Pellwick. Our orders table is partitioned by month, and a nightly job creates next month's partition ahead of time. If inserts start failing near month boundaries, the job likely didn't run. Don't create partitions by hand without checking naming conventions first. The partition maintenance procedure is documented on the internal page below.

operations page: https://jira.zemvarlabs.internal/pages/browse/pages/2456c046